Output 85f382d41bad14f2cbf8880632a14652e8d69c436a55539592fe22c6948d488f:0

value
850814
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5579c37271bd35c24ef7cbd1c4fbd95cc108588 OP_EQUALVERIFY OP_CHECKSIG
address
1MuehCEi2mbXuhgLWZu4jECDvSwZqn7fBd
transaction
85f382d41bad14f2cbf8880632a14652e8d69c436a55539592fe22c6948d488f
confirmations
417741
spent
true